![]() It’s main use can be determined when you would need to revert something from the live environment. It is a set of automated process which will help in improving performance and to detect some issue which can’t be easily detected. OCTOPUS TEAMCITY SOFTWARECompare the similarities and differences between software options with real user reviews focused on features, ease of use, customer service, and value for money. The CI/CD helps to the deliver the application more effectively and efficiently and saves a lot of time. Octopus Deploy has 36 reviews and a rating of 4.83 / 5 stars vs TeamCity which has 40 reviews and a rating of 4.58 / 5 stars. This whole process helps to reach the code from developers machine to the production environment. During the tentacle installed we have to define the extraction path where will the application resides. OCTOPUS TEAMCITY INSTALLFor this we would need to install octopus tentacle on the machine which will give the authentication certificate which we would need to give to the octopus server to the add it as a target. Typically the deployments machines needs to added in the octopus server. Octopus pipeline also contains some process which can be executed as a part of the process according to the need of the application. ![]() Once the release is created we can trigger the deployment on any environment or any machine. Octopus Process - Image from demo octopus server This all process is very simple in teamCity using the plugins provided. Octopus Deploy is a deployment automation server, designed to make it easy to orchestrate releases and deploy applications, whether on-premises or in the. We can tell the octopus project name to the teamCity where we have to create the same version. This is a way to maintain the versioning because we want to have the same version of the build which was on the teamCity should be same on Octopus and the machine too. Once the package is published we have a step in the TeamCity to create a release in the octopus deploy. There are many artifact repository like Azure devops, nuget etc where we can push the package. ![]() At the end when all the compile, build, running tests process is completed we typically do the packaging of the code and push it to the artifact repository which will help the continuous deployment to to acquire the package in extract it to the specific machine. ![]() While the build steps are in progress the agent reports the TeamCity server sending the log messages of the process. Then after that the agent executes the steps defined in the build process. TeamCity - Plugins - Image from TeamCity docs 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|